Abstract
The role financial institutions have played in the growth and development of Nigeria economy can not be overemphasized. There had been a growing realization of the importance of financial institutions in the growth and development of Nigerian economy due to the credit facility and various other services it rendered. The objectives of the study is to access the impact of Nigeria Agricultural Co-operative and Rural Development Bank (NACROB) in Enugu Zonal Headquarter on socio-economic status or rural farmers, and evaluate the National – livestock small holders loans scheme under the NACRDB among farmer in Enugu North. The instruments for data collection is through personal interview and administration of questionnaire as her primary source of data collection by the researcher and the sampling size of the study were 40 professional fishermen as beneficiaries and 25 people as non-beneficiaries. The method employed is through personal visit to NACRDB at Nsukka representative office. The data obtain in the questionnaires administered were scored and the percentages were calculated and presented in frequency tables. From the information gathered, it was observed that fishermen beneficiaries benefited from the loans and other services rendered by NACRDB as they purchased more of fishing impute while the Non-beneficiaries enjoyed little or no benefits at all. It was concluded that right policies should be put in place and the constraints identified in the study be address.
